Plaza Blanca, a breathtaking hiking area in Abiquiu, New Mexico, is renowned for its stunning white rock formations and dramatic landscapes. This scenic spot offers visitors a unique opportunity to explore nature's artistry while immersing themselves in the tranquility of the desert. Whether you're an avid hiker or a casual observer, Plaza Blanca promises to leave you with unforgettable memories and spectacular views.

Local tips

  • Visit early in the morning or late in the afternoon for the best lighting for photography.
  • Wear sturdy hiking shoes as the terrain can be uneven and rocky.
  • Bring plenty of water and snacks, as there are no facilities on site.
  • Consider bringing a sketchbook or camera to capture the stunning landscapes.
  • Check the weather forecast before your visit to ensure a safe hiking experience.

Getting There

  • Car

    From the center of Carson National Forest, head southwest towards NM-518 S. Drive approximately 15 miles until you reach the junction with US-84 S. Turn left onto US-84 S and continue for about 12 miles. After this, use the right lane to merge onto US-84 S/NM-96 W toward Abiquiu. Continue on US-84 S for approximately 15 miles. When you reach the town of Abiquiu, turn left onto Co Rd 155, and follow this road for about 2 miles. Plaza Blanca will be on your left at the address 342 Co Rd 155, Abiquiu, NM 87510. Parking is available on-site.

  • Public Transportation

    While public transportation options are limited in rural New Mexico, you can take a bus from Santa Fe to Abiquiu through the New Mexico Park and Ride service. Once you arrive in Abiquiu, you will need to arrange for a taxi or rideshare service to reach Plaza Blanca. The distance from the bus stop in Abiquiu to Plaza Blanca is approximately 5 miles, which may not be walkable due to the lack of pedestrian pathways.

  • Bicycle

    If you are feeling adventurous and have a bicycle, you can bike from the center of Carson National Forest to Plaza Blanca. Follow the same route as the car directions until you reach NM-518 S. From there, continue towards US-84 S and then Co Rd 155. Note that the total distance is around 42 miles one way, and you should be prepared for a strenuous ride with elevation changes.

  • Walking

    Walking from anywhere in Carson National Forest to Plaza Blanca is not recommended due to the long distances and lack of established walking paths. If you are already nearby, ensure you have a reliable map and sufficient supplies, and be prepared for a lengthy trek, as the nearest access point is several miles away.

Discover more about Plaza Blanca

Plaza Blanca, often referred to as 'The White Place,' is a hidden gem located in the heart of Abiquiu, New Mexico. This enchanting hiking area is celebrated for its striking white rock formations that rise majestically against the backdrop of the vibrant New Mexico sky. As you traverse the trails, you will encounter a breathtaking landscape characterized by dramatic cliffs, deep canyons, and unique geological features that have captivated artists and nature lovers alike. The serene environment provides a perfect escape for those looking to connect with nature, offering a tranquil setting that encourages reflection and inspiration. The site is not only a favorite among hikers but also an artist's paradise. Many renowned painters, including the famous Georgia O'Keeffe, drew inspiration from the ethereal beauty of Plaza Blanca. As you hike, take the time to appreciate the play of light and shadow on the rocks, which creates mesmerizing visual spectacles throughout the day. The trails are well-marked and cater to varying levels of hiking experience, making it accessible for families and solo adventurers alike. Visitors are encouraged to explore the area, but it's essential to respect the natural surroundings to preserve its beauty for future generations. With its open hours from 9 AM to 5 PM, Plaza Blanca invites you to experience the magic of this scenic spot. Whether you're seeking adventure, peace, or artistic inspiration, Plaza Blanca remains a must-visit destination that encapsulates the essence of New Mexico's stunning landscapes.
